A success that was announced, that of the third Italian Gravel Championship which in the splendid setting of Golferenzo, in the Oltrepò Pavese, crowned Giada Borghesi and Samuele Zoccarato with the tricolor title in a race with over 300 athletes at the start.

It took Samuele Zoccarato 4 hours, 18 minutes and 20 seconds to wear the Italian Gravel Champion jersey again, the Paduan who inaugurated the roll of honor of the national event in 2022 in Argenta (FE) with the success of Golferenzo hangs up the coveted green-white-red jersey in the closet. Along the 126 km of the test, held over three laps of the tough circuit, the road racer from San Giorgio delle Pertiche took victory alone thanks to a decisive attack during the second lap. “The race was tough, the route beautiful and very technical. As a pure road racer, I suffered a bit keeping up with the wheels of those who also do MTB or Gravel, but my condition is good and I managed to attack at the right time” says the winner of the day. A luxury double for VF Group Bardiani CSF Faizanè with second place by Luca Colnaghi. Author of a great finale, the Lecco native and Zoccarato’s teammate got the better of Filippo Agostinacchio right along the last climb that preceded the finish line. Also due to a broken derailleur, the reigning Italian U23 Cyclocross champion of Beltrami TSA Tre Colli had to settle for third place, which still left him satisfied.

The women’s challenge of the 1st ‘GP Borgo dei Gatti’ saw the talent of Giada Borghesi triumph: the thirty-year-old born in 2002, fresh from a fall at the Italian Road Championship last week and from an intestinal virus on Friday, demonstrated its strength by imposing itself on its opponents. After managing the first part of the race in a trio with teammate Carlotta Borello and biker Debora Piana, Borghesi launched the decisive attack in the last kilometers which allowed her to arrive alone with arms raised at the finish line in Golferenzo . “I remained calm for almost the entire race because I didn’t feel like taking risks and leaving too early, but I did well because in the end I conserved the energy I needed to attack. I’m really happy to have reconfirmed myself, demonstrating my good condition despite the illness I had during the week” added Borghesi enthusiastically. Borello and Piana completed the women’s podium, with the mountain biker from Vicenza now transplanted to Trentino who recalled at the finish line: “Gravel is a discipline that I like and that I use as preparation for my MTB races. I’m happy to have reached the podium also because the girls who preceded me are road riders and on some sections of the route they were more favored than me”.

Also competing was a large group of Master athletes: Lorena Zocca, the Italian champion, confirmed in the women’s category with the best overall and category time (W4), while in the men’s category Nicolò Ferrazzo set the best time (M1). In the Master 8 category, it is impossible not to mention the success of Silvano Janes, who reached his 49th national title.

Men’s Open

1 Zoccarato Samuele Vf Group–Bardiani Csf–Faizane’ 04:18:20; 2 Colnaghi Luca Vf Group–Bardiani Csf–Faizane’ 04:23:08; 3 Agostinacchio Filippo Beltrami Tsa Tre Colli 04:23:21; 4 De Marchi Mattia Enough Cycling Collective 04:25:11; 5 Marengo Umberto Mentecorpo Cicli Drigani Pro Team 04:25:25

Women’s Open

1 Borghesi Giada Btc City Ljubljana Zhiraf Ambedo 03:22:30; 2 Borello Carlotta Btc City Ljubljana Zhiraf Ambedo 03:23:11; 3 Piana Debora Team Cingolani 03:23:29; 4 Oberleiter Anna Team Cingolani 03:38:45; 5 Lechner Eva Army Sports Center 03:40:44
